Fraser Health is responsible for the delivery of hospital and community-based health services to over 1.9 million people in 20 diverse communities from Burnaby to Fraser Canyon on the traditional territories of the Coast Salish and Nlaka'pamux Nations.

Our team of nearly 40,000 staff, medical staff and volunteers is dedicated to serving our patients, families and communities to deliver on our vision:
Better health, best in health care.

Position Highlights:

The

Portfolio Manager, Vendor Management provides strategic leadership, innovative services and hands-on expertise to Fraser Health executive, ensuring effective vendor management and procurement occurs in alignment with the Fraser Health goals and objectives. The

Portfolio Manager, Vendor Management will optimize vendor relationships and contribute to the organization's success by optimizing partnerships, driving efficiency, mitigating risks, and fostering innovation.


Responsibilities include:


  • Establishing key performance indicators (KPIs) and metrics to measure vendor performance and service quality.
  • Regularly review vendor performance data and provide feedback to drive continuous improvement.
  • Ensure contract compliance and monitor vendor performance against SLAs to establish clear expectations and deliverables. Address performance issues and initiate corrective actions when necessary.
  • Review, challenge and process vendor invoices, actively manage to budget targets
  • Lead vendor performance review meetings and drive initiatives to enhance service quality and efficiency.
  • Stay up to date on industry trends and best practices to leverage emerging technologies and methodologies.
  • Coordinate enterprise agreement and recurring contract renewals, modifications and support negotiations.
  • Maintain a repository of vendorrelated documentation, metrics, contracts, and performance data.
  • Cultivate strong ongoing relationships with key vendors, serving as the primary point of contact.
  • Facilitate regular communication between internal and external stakeholders to ensure alignment and collaboration.
  • Manage conflicts and disputes that may arise between the organization and vendors.
  • Hire, mentor and supervise direct reports assigned, to support the department objectives
  • Engage with internal stakeholders, including project managers, procurement teams, and senior leadership, to align vendor management strategies with overall business goals.
  • Support and contribute to comprehensive strategic plans for vendor management, procurement and termination.
  • Collaborate with crossfunctional teams to define service requirements, conduct evaluations and assessments to ensure vendors meet quality, cost, and service expectations.
  • Assist with financial forecasting and budget planning to achieve cost savings and value for the organization.
  • Collaborate with stakeholder teams to ensure vendorrelated changes align with change management processes and manage the impact of vendorrelated changes on projects and operations.
